Perhaps the most interesting game of the upcoming weekend in the Premier League will see Tottenham hosting Manchester United as Saturday's primetime match. Both teams get to this game after suffering heart-breaking losses, and this should give both sides a prime chance to get back to winning ways.

Nuno Espirito Santo's men enter this game ranked sixth in the English top-flight with a record showing five wins and four losses. Nuno's men have found the back of the net nine times, but their defense has not been as on point as expected, conceding thirteen goals in their nine matches. Three of Tottenham's four home games have seen them claim all the points, although they were also defeated by Chelsea in their next-to-last game prior to Manchester United's visit.

Speaking of individual performances, Tottenham will be eager to watch Harry Kane going back to his old form. The English striker has only been able to score and assist once this season, giving fans reasons to think he is still eager on leaving the club. On the contrary, South Korean ace Son Heung-Min has led the team so far with four goals, making him and Kane the major threats against Ole Gunnar Solskjaer's crew.

On the other hand, Manchester United enter this game after being dismantled by Liverpool in front of their supporters. While coach Solskjaer has been facing an escalating amount of pressure, the board is still behind him despite a start of the season where they have won four, drawn two, and lost three. As previously mentioned, their last outing ended in disaster, but that was not exclusive of last weekend's game, as their most recent match away from home also concluded with a heavy 4-2 loss to Leicester City.

Despite these facts, Manchester United still have the tools to turn their situation around, and one of those tools is none other than Cristiano Ronaldo. The Portuguese footballer shares the team's top scorer honors with Mason Greenwood (both with four), and he will surely be the main threat to Tottenham's defense. In Paul Pogba's absence, Bruno Fernandes should step up and carry the team's weight along with his compatriot if they want to keep their coach under pressure at least for the next few days.

These two teams have delivered us some spectacular matches in the past, and with both of them in need of a win right now, we can only look forward to see them collide at Tottenham Hotspur Stadium.

Tottenham Hotspur vs Manchester United - Head-to-head stats

  • The last game between these teams ended in a 3-1 victory for Manchester United back in April.

  • Manchester United have won two of their last five away games against Tottenham.

  • Tottenham have not defeated Manchester United while playing as hosts since January 2018, when they claimed a 3-1 win over the Red Devils.

  • Spurs' last win against Manchester United took place on October 4, 2020. That game ended with a record-breaking 6-1 victory for the North London side.

  • In his first stint at Old Trafford, Cristiano Ronaldo scored ten goals against Tottenham in all competitions.

  • This will be Nuno Espirito Santo's tenth game against Manchester United. The Portuguese coach has a record of two wins, four draws, and three losses against the Red Devils.

  • Manchester United's coach Ole Gunnar Solskjaer will face Tottenham for the seventh time as the Red Devils' boss. So far, the Norwegian tactician has won three of those games, with one draw, and two losses to complete his tally.
